Good job on the door art pics Dice.
It saddens me not to have had the foresight to take pics of the 930th jet's doors back in the day. Especially mine on 77-0181.
It was "Conan the Destroyer"
I've got a pic of my Dad and I standing by it, but that's the only pic I have.
If you recall the A-10 door at McClellan's museum of the red haired lady with the 45 over her breasts, that was one of ours too.
The aircraft was 77-0245, the original artwork was a pair of 45 Colts crossed over her. The meaning of course was obvious.
"Gentleman's Delight" 76-0535 and "Battlin Badger" 77-0184 are in a door art book were also from the 930th.
Those three are the only ones I know that were ever documented.
